Analysis

In 2017, quasi-money, money plus quasi-money (depository corporations survey) in Hong Kong stood at 30.2 units per US$ of GDP. That is the highest value across all 27 years on record.

That represents a change of up 3.3% on the previous year and up 30.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, quasi-money, money plus quasi-money (depository corporations survey) in Hong Kong peaked at 30.2 units per US$ of GDP in 2017 and was at its lowest, 12.41 units per US$ of GDP, in 1994.

Hong Kong ranks 64th of 159 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 27 years of available data.

How this figure is calculated

Quasi-Money, Money plus Quasi-Money (Depository Corporations Survey, Domestic currency) divided by GDP (current US$),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.

Quasi-Money, Money plus Quasi-Money (Depository Corporations Survey, Domestic currency) ÷ GDP (current US$)
